Objectives of the Course
At the end of this lesson, students can create a computer lab, maintain an existing laboratory,add a new network terminal, printer, solve the problems that may, configure server in the laboratory , create new users, have possess the knowledge that can regulate the user's rights and properties.

Course Contents
Foundations and architecture of computer networks. Network operating systems. Computer networks and users. Local computer networks management. Electronic mail, computer conferencing, distance education and their educational applications.
